Neighborhood Overview
Belleville Bowling & Sport Shop is situated in the heart of Belleville, Illinois, a vibrant city with a strong community spirit. It’s conveniently located along East Main Street, a primary artery that connects various parts of the city and offers easy access to surrounding towns. Major thoroughfares like Illinois Route 15 and the nearby Interstate 64 provide excellent connectivity to the greater St. Louis metropolitan area, located just a short drive across the river. Parking is available directly at the venue, with additional street parking options on Main Street and surrounding side streets. For those arriving from further afield, Lambert-St. Louis International Airport (STL) is approximately a 40-50 minute drive, depending on traffic. Rideshare services are readily available in the area, offering a convenient alternative to driving and parking, especially during peak hours or league nights. Planning your arrival a few minutes before your scheduled time is always advisable to account for finding parking and navigating any potential local traffic.

Weather & Seasons
Winter
Winter in Belleville can be chilly to cold, with average temperatures ranging from the low 20s to the mid-40s Fahrenheit. Layered clothing, including coats, hats, and gloves, is essential for any outdoor excursions. The cold weather makes the indoor environment of the bowling alley a welcome refuge, offering warmth and consistent conditions for your games. Driving conditions can sometimes be affected by ice or snow, so checking forecasts and allowing extra travel time is prudent.
Spring & early summer
Spring brings milder temperatures, with highs generally in the 60s and 70s Fahrenheit, making it a pleasant time for activities. Early summer continues this trend before the peak heat arrives. Light jackets or sweaters are often useful for cooler mornings and evenings. This season is excellent for enjoying the bowling alley and also for exploring the surrounding town on foot or visiting nearby parks without the intense summer heat.
Mid-summer
Mid-summer in Belleville is typically hot and humid, with daily temperatures frequently reaching into the 80s and 90s Fahrenheit, sometimes higher. Staying hydrated and seeking air-conditioned environments is key. The bowling alley provides a perfect cool escape from the summer heat, ensuring a comfortable gaming experience. Lighter clothing is the norm, but sun protection is advised for any time spent outdoors between events.
Fall season
Fall offers beautiful transitional weather, with temperatures cooling down into the 50s and 70s Fahrenheit as the season progresses. This crisp air is invigorating and perfect for outdoor strolls before or after bowling. Autumn colors can make the local scenery particularly picturesque. It’s a comfortable time to be outdoors briefly, but warmer layers are advisable for evenings and cooler days.
Rain & snow
Belleville experiences rainfall throughout the year, with heavier amounts possible in spring and summer. Winter can bring mixed precipitation, including snow, though significant accumulations are not always guaranteed. During inclement weather, indoor venues like Belleville Bowling & Sport Shop are ideal, offering uninterrupted fun. Always have an umbrella handy for light rain, and be prepared for potentially slippery conditions on roads and sidewalks if snow or ice is in the forecast.
